If you hover the mouse over a menu long enough, the list expands to include all the options found there. Or you can expand a menu more quickly by clicking the double down arrows at the bottom of the menu list. As you use menu items, they appear immediately, but items that you haven't ever used don't appear unless you click the double arrows. Some folks like this approach; others don't. If you don't like the way menus or toolbars work in PowerPoint, you can change them. To find out how, see p. 371.

18. When you use the Send to Microsoft Word feature, your slides become images in a Microsoft Word document. At this point you're in Word, and you can edit, save, or print the resulting Word document. To return to PowerPoint, you simply close Word or click the PowerPoint button on the Windows taskbar.
